South Bend Redevelopment Commission <br />Regular Meeting -August 6, 2010 <br />6. NEW BUSINESS (CONT.) <br />D. South Side Development Area <br />(1) continued... <br />Mr. Schalliol noted that staff solicited a <br />proposal from Lawson-Fisher Associates to <br />provide engineering services for an access <br />study for Norman Street at South Michigan <br />Street. Several years ago the city made <br />improvements to Michigan Street between <br />the bypass and Chippewa. That work <br />included anon-mountable median at Ireland. <br />That median seems to have created a traffic <br />hazard as southbound traffic wants to turn <br />into the new Culvers. The purpose of the <br />proposal is to study traffic patterns at and <br />around the intersection and to make a <br />deternlination as to whether the lane <br />restrictions made on South Michigan Street <br />can be modified to provide safer access to <br />Norman Street. hnproved access to Norman <br />Sheet would help Culver"s Restaurant <br />currently located at the intersection as well as <br />improve the developability of the land to the <br />north of Norman Street. <br />The proposal is a not to exceed amount of <br />52,500.00. Staff requests favorable approval <br />of this proposal. <br />Upon a motion by Mr. Downes, seconded by <br />Mr. Alford and unanimously carried, the <br />Commission accepted the proposal from <br />Lawson-Fisher Associates for the scope of <br />services proposed and an amount not to <br />exceed 52,500. <br />(2) Resolution No. 2709 approving and <br />accepting a counter offer for propert~~ <br />located at 748 Hawbaker Street (Vacant <br />house) <br />25 <br />COMMISSION ACCEPTED THE PROPOSAL FROM <br />LAWSON-FISHER ASSOCIATES FOR THE SCOPE OF <br />SERVICES PROPOSED AND AN AMOUNT NOT TO <br />EXCEED $2,500 <br />
